
如何在虚拟机里装Deepin
在虚拟机里装Deepin的过程包括:下载Deepin ISO镜像、选择合适的虚拟机软件、创建新的虚拟机、配置虚拟机设置、安装Deepin系统。其中,选择合适的虚拟机软件是关键,因为不同的虚拟机软件在性能、功能和用户体验上有不同的表现,选择适合自己需求的软件能大大提升安装和使用体验。
一、下载Deepin ISO镜像
首先,访问Deepin的官方网站(https://www.deepin.org/),在下载页面找到最新版本的Deepin系统镜像文件(ISO格式)。Deepin是基于Debian的Linux发行版,提供简洁、美观和用户友好的界面。下载完成后,确保文件的完整性,可以使用SHA256校验和工具来验证下载的ISO文件。
二、选择合适的虚拟机软件
选择合适的虚拟机软件对安装和使用体验有很大的影响。常见的虚拟机软件包括:
- VMware Workstation:功能强大,支持多种操作系统,性能优秀,但需要付费。
- Oracle VM VirtualBox:开源免费,功能较为全面,适合个人用户和小型团队。
- Microsoft Hyper-V:集成在Windows专业版及以上版本中,性能稳定,适合Windows用户。
在选择虚拟机软件时,需要考虑自己的需求和预算。如果你需要强大的功能和高性能,推荐使用VMware Workstation;如果你希望使用免费软件,VirtualBox是不错的选择。
三、创建新的虚拟机
以VirtualBox为例,创建新的虚拟机的步骤如下:
- 打开VirtualBox,点击“新建”按钮。
- 在弹出的窗口中,输入虚拟机的名称,并选择操作系统类型为“Linux”,版本选择“Debian (64-bit)”。
- 分配虚拟机内存,建议分配至少2GB的内存,以确保系统流畅运行。
- 创建虚拟硬盘,选择“VDI (VirtualBox Disk Image)”格式,并分配合适的硬盘空间(建议至少20GB)。
四、配置虚拟机设置
在创建好虚拟机后,需要对其进行一些基本的配置,以确保Deepin系统能够正常安装和运行:
- 选择刚创建的虚拟机,点击“设置”按钮。
- 在“系统”选项卡中,确保启用EFI(如果需要使用UEFI引导)。
- 在“显示”选项卡中,分配足够的显存(建议至少128MB)并启用3D加速。
- 在“存储”选项卡中,添加下载的Deepin ISO镜像文件作为光盘驱动器。
- 在“网络”选项卡中,选择NAT模式或桥接模式,以确保虚拟机能够访问互联网。
五、安装Deepin系统
配置完成后,启动虚拟机开始安装Deepin系统:
- 启动虚拟机,在启动过程中选择从ISO镜像启动。
- 进入Deepin安装界面,选择安装语言(例如中文或英文)。
- 根据提示进行分区,选择自动分区或手动分区。
- 设置用户信息,包括用户名、密码和计算机名称。
- 点击“安装”按钮,等待安装过程完成,期间可能需要几分钟到几十分钟不等。
六、安装后配置和优化
安装完成后,重启虚拟机,进入Deepin系统进行一些基本配置和优化:
- 安装虚拟机增强工具:在VirtualBox中,安装增强工具(Guest Additions)以提高显示性能和支持共享文件夹。
- 更新系统:打开Deepin终端,运行
sudo apt update && sudo apt upgrade命令,确保系统软件包是最新版本。 - 安装必要软件:根据个人需求,安装常用软件包,如开发工具、办公软件等。
七、常见问题及解决方案
在安装和使用过程中,可能会遇到一些常见问题,以下是一些解决方案:
- 显示分辨率问题:如果虚拟机显示分辨率无法调整,可以尝试重新安装虚拟机增强工具。
- 网络连接问题:确保虚拟机网络设置正确,选择合适的网络模式(NAT或桥接)。
- 系统性能问题:如果虚拟机运行缓慢,可以尝试增加分配的内存和CPU核心数。
八、总结
通过上述步骤,可以在虚拟机中成功安装并运行Deepin系统。选择合适的虚拟机软件、合理配置虚拟机设置、及时更新和优化系统是确保良好使用体验的关键。在团队协作和项目管理中,推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ile,以提升工作效率和团队协作能力。
相关问答FAQs:
1. 在虚拟机中安装deepin有哪些步骤?
-
如何创建一个新的虚拟机?
- 打开虚拟机软件,点击创建新的虚拟机。
- 选择deepin的ISO文件作为虚拟机的安装媒介。
- 设置虚拟机的硬件参数,如内存大小、磁盘空间等。
- 完成虚拟机的创建。
-
如何安装deepin操作系统?
- 启动虚拟机,并选择deepin的ISO文件作为启动媒介。
- 进入deepin的安装界面,选择安装deepin操作系统。
- 根据安装向导的提示,选择安装位置、分配磁盘空间等。
- 等待安装过程完成,重启虚拟机。
-
如何配置deepin操作系统?
- 登录到deepin操作系统,按照向导进行初始设置。
- 设置语言、时区、网络连接等基本配置。
- 安装所需的软件和驱动程序。
- 根据个人喜好进行主题、壁纸等外观设置。
2. 虚拟机和物理机上安装deepin有什么区别?
-
虚拟机中安装deepin的优势是什么?
- 可以在不影响物理机系统的情况下尝试deepin操作系统。
- 可以随时删除或重新创建虚拟机,方便测试和实验。
- 虚拟机可以与物理机隔离,避免对物理机造成潜在的风险。
-
虚拟机中安装deepin的劣势是什么?
- 虚拟机的性能可能受到限制,无法完全发挥deepin操作系统的潜力。
- 虚拟机的资源分配可能受到限制,无法满足一些高性能需求。
- 在虚拟机中安装deepin可能会占用较多的磁盘空间。
3. 如何解决在虚拟机中安装deepin时遇到的问题?
-
虚拟机启动时出现错误如何解决?
- 确保虚拟机软件和deepin的ISO文件都是最新版本。
- 检查虚拟机的硬件参数是否符合deepin的要求。
- 尝试重新创建虚拟机,确保安装过程中没有出现错误。
-
安装deepin过程中出现安装失败的情况该怎么办?
- 检查ISO文件的完整性和正确性,尝试重新下载或使用其他镜像源。
- 确保虚拟机的硬件参数和资源分配满足deepin的要求。
- 尝试在其他虚拟机软件中安装deepin,以排除软件兼容性问题。
-
安装deepin后无法正常运行或出现其他问题该怎么办?
- 更新deepin操作系统和相关驱动程序,确保使用最新的版本。
- 在deepin官方论坛或社区寻求帮助,查找类似问题的解决方案。
- 考虑重新安装deepin操作系统,以确保安装过程没有出现错误。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2787236